Skip to content

xcode14.0 Bindings Status

tj_devel709 edited this page Sep 16, 2022 · 331 revisions

Do not directly modify the following table (it's generated) or the script (without discussions)

framework iOS tvOS watchOS macOS
_DeviceDiscoveryUI_SwiftUI - b1 nothing
- -
Accessibility b1 nothing
b1 nothing
b1 nothing
b1 nothing
rc ???
Accounts b1 nothing
- - b1 nothing
rc ???
ActivityKit b4 nothing
rc ???
- - -
AddressBook - - - b1 nothing
rc ???
AppClip b1 nothing
- - -
AppIntents b1 nothing
b1 nothing
b1 nothing
b1 nothing
rc ???
AppKit - - - b1 PR15778
b2 nothing
b3 PR15778
b4 PR15778
b5 PR15778
rc mandel
ARKit b1 PR15408
- - -
AudioToolbox b1 PR15877
b2 PR15877
b3 PR15877
b1 PR15877
b2 PR15877
b3 PR15877
- b1 PR15877
b2 PR15877
b3 PR15877
rc ???
AuthenticationServices b1 PR15427
b2 PR15427
b4 PR15604
b1 PR15427
b2 PR15427
b4 PR15604
b1 PR15427
b2 PR15427
b4 PR15604
b1 PR15427
b2 PR15427
b4 PR15604
rc ???
AutomaticAssessmentConfiguration b5 PR15742
- - b5 PR15742
rc ???
AVFAudio b1 mandel
b2 mandel
b3 mandel
b4 mandel
b1 mandel
b2 mandel
b3 mandel
b4 mandel
b1 mandel
b2 mandel
b3 mandel
b4 mandel
b1 mandel
b2 mandel
b3 mandel
b4 mandel
rc ???
AVFoundation b1 mandel
b2 mandel
b3 mandel
b4 mandel
b5 mandel
rc ???
b1 mandel
b2 mandel
b3 mandel
b4 mandel
b5 mandel
rc ???
b1 mandel
b2 mandel
b3 mandel
b4 mandel
b5 mandel
rc ???
b1 mandel
b2 mandel
b3 mandel
b4 mandel
b5 mandel
rc ???
AVKit b1 PR15811
b2 PR15811
b3 PR15811
b1 PR15811
b2 PR15811
- b1 PR15811
b2 PR15811
rc ???
AVRouting b1 PR15811
b2 PR15811
- - b2 PR15811
rc ???
BackgroundAssets b1 PR15649
b2 PR15649
b4 PR15649
b5 nothing
rc ???
- - b1 PR15649
b2 PR15649
b4 PR15649
b5 nothing
rc ???
CalendarStore - - - b1 nothing
rc ???
CallKit b1 PR15411
- b1 PR15411
b1 PR15411
rc ???
Carbon - - - b1 nothing
rc ???
CarPlay b1 PR15403
b2 PR15403
- - -
CellularDataDiagnosticsSuite b2 nothing
- - -
CHIP b1 nothing
b2 nothing
b4 nothing
b5 nothing
b1 nothing
b2 nothing
b4 nothing
b5 nothing
b1 nothing
b2 nothing
b4 nothing
b5 nothing
b1 nothing
b2 nothing
b4 nothing
rc ???
ClockKit b1 PR15417
b2 PR15417
- b1 PR15417
b2 PR15417
-
CloudKit b1 PR15546
b2 PR15546
b5 nothing
b1 PR15546
b2 PR15546
b5 nothing
b1 PR15546
b2 PR15546
b5 nothing
b1 PR15546
b2 PR15546
b5 nothing
rc ???
Contacts b1 nothing
- b1 nothing
b1 nothing
rc ???
CoreAudio - - - b1 nothing
b4 ???
rc ???
CoreAudioKit b1 PR15418
b2 PR15418
- - b1 PR15418
b2 PR15418
rc ???
CoreAudioTypes b1 mandel
b1 mandel
b1 mandel
b1 mandel
rc ???
CoreBluetooth b1 PR15419
b1 PR15419
b1 PR15419
b1 PR15419
rc ???
CoreData b1 nothing
b2 nothing
b1 nothing
b2 nothing
b1 nothing
b2 nothing
b1 nothing
rc ???
CoreFoundation b1 nothing
b2 nothing
b4 PR15799
b1 nothing
b2 nothing
b4 PR15799
b1 nothing
b2 nothing
b4 PR15799
b1 nothing
b2 nothing
b4 PR15799
b5 chamons
rc ???
CoreGraphics b1 PR15831
b2 PR15831
b4 PR15831
b1 PR15831
b2 PR15831
b4 PR15831
b1 PR15831
b2 PR15831
b4 PR15831
b1 PR15831
b2 PR15831
b5 nothing
rc ???
CoreHaptics b1 PR15523
b1 PR15523
- b1 PR15523
rc ???
CoreImage b1 PR15661
b3 PR15661
b1 PR15661
b3 PR15661
- b1 PR15661
b3 PR15661
rc ???
CoreLocation b1 nothing
b2 nothing
rc PR15985
b1 nothing
b2 nothing
rc PR15985
b1 nothing
b2 nothing
rc PR15985
b1 nothing
b2 nothing
rc PR15985
CoreMedia b1 PR15524
b1 PR15524
b1 PR15524
b1 PR15524
rc ???
CoreMIDI b1 PR15917
b1 PR15917
b1 PR15917
b1 PR15917
rc ???
CoreML b1 PR15527
b3 PR15527
b1 PR15527
b3 PR15527
b1 PR15527
b3 PR15527
b1 PR15527
b3 PR15527
rc ???
CoreMotion b1 nothing
b2 nothing
rc PR15977
- b1 nothing
b2 nothing
rc PR15977
b1 nothing
b2 nothing
rc PR15977
CoreNFC b1 PR15528
- - -
CoreSpotlight b1 PR15532
b2 PR15532
b4 PR15605
b5 PR15701
b1 PR15532
b2 PR15532
b4 PR15605
rc ???
- b1 PR15532
b2 PR15532
b4 PR15605
b5 PR15701
rc ???
CoreTelephony b1 PR15533
b3 PR15533
- - b1 PR15533
b3 PR15533
rc ???
CoreText b1 PRfiles
b2 PRfiles
b4 PR15606
b5 nothing
b1 PRfiles
b2 PRfiles
b4 PR15606
b5 nothing
b1 PRfiles
b2 PRfiles
b4 PR15606
b5 nothing
b1 PRfiles
b2 PRfiles
b4 PR15606
b5 nothing
rc ???
CoreTransferable b1 nothing
b1 nothing
b1 nothing
b1 nothing
rc ???
CoreVideo b1 PR15833
b2 nothing
b1 PR15833
b2 nothing
b1 PR15833
b2 nothing
b1 PR15833
b2 nothing
rc ???
CoreWLAN - - - b1 PR15856
b2 PR15856
b4 PR15856
rc ???
DeviceAccess - - - b1 issoto
b2 issoto
DeviceCheck b1 PR15639
b1 PR15639
b1 PR15639
b1 PR15639
rc ???
DeviceDiscoveryExtension b1 PR15741
b2 PR15741
b3 PR15741
b4 PR15741
b1 nothing
b2 nothing
b3 nothing
b4 nothing
b1 nothing
b2 nothing
b3 nothing
b4 nothing
b2 nothing
b3 nothing
b4 nothing
DeviceDiscoveryUI - b1 PR15762
- -
EventKit b1 PR15542
- b1 PR15542
b1 PR15542
rc ???
EventKitUI b1 nothing
- - -
ExecutionPolicy - - - b1 PR15641
rc ???
ExtensionFoundation b1 nothing
b3 nothing
b1 nothing
b3 nothing
b1 nothing
b3 nothing
b1 nothing
b3 nothing
rc ???
ExtensionKit b1 PR15548
b2 PR15548
b1 PR15548
b2 PR15548
b1 PR15548
b1 PR15548
b2 PR15548
rc ???
FileProvider b1 PR15777
b2 PR15777
b3 PR15777
b4 PR15777
- - b1 PR15777
b2 PR15777
b3 PR15777
b4 PR15777
rc ???
FinderSync - - - b1 nothing
rc ???
Foundation b1 PR
b2 nothing
b3 nothing
b4 PR
b5 nothing
b1 PR
b2 nothing
b3 nothing
b4 PR
b5 nothing
rc ???
b1 PR
b2 nothing
b3 nothing
b4 PR
b5 nothing
rc ???
b1 PR
b2 nothing
b3 nothing
b4 PR
b5 nothing
rc ???
FSEvents - - - b1 PR15707
rc ???
FWAUserLib - - - b1 nothing
rc ???
GameController b1 PR15692
b2 PR15692
b4 PR15692
b5 PR15692
b1 PR15692
b2 PR15692
b4 PR15692
b5 PR15692
- b1 PR15692
b2 PR15692
b4 PR15692
b5 PR15692
rc ???
GameKit b1 PR15557
b2 PR15557
b4 PR15607
b5 nothing
b1 PR15557
b2 PR15557
b4 PR15607
b1 PR15557
b2 PR15557
b4 PR15607
b1 PR15557
b2 PR15557
b4 PR15607
rc ???
HealthKit b1 PR15612
b3 PR15612
b4 PR15612
b5 PR15612
rc PR15956
- b1 PR15612
b3 PR15612
b4 PR15612
b5 PR15612
rc PR15956
b1 PR15612
b3 PR15612
b4 PR15612
b5 PR15612
rc PR15956
HealthKitUI b1 PR15640
- - -
HomeKit b1 nothing
b2 nothing
b4 PR15650
b5 nothing
b1 nothing
b2 nothing
b4 PR15650
b5 nothing
b1 nothing
b2 nothing
b4 PR15650
b5 nothing
-
IdentityLookup b1 PR15740
- - b1 PR15740
rc ???
ImageIO b1 PR15779
b3 PR15779
b1 PR15779
b3 PR15779
b1 PR15779
b3 PR15779
b1 PR15779
b3 PR15779
rc ???
ImageKit - - - b1 nothing
rc ???
Intents b1 PR15703
b1 PR15703
b1 PR15703
b1 PR15703
rc ???
IntentsUI - - - b1 PR15704
rc ???
IOSurface b1 PR15706
b1 PR15706
- b1 PR15706
rc ???
iTunesLibrary - - - b5 PR15705
rc ???
LaunchServices - - - b1 PR15859
b2 PR15859
rc ???
LinkPresentation b1 nothing
b1 nothing
- b1 nothing
rc ???
LocalAuthentication b1 PR15873
b2 PR15873
b3 PR15873
- b1 PR15873
b2 PR15873
b1 PR15873
b2 PR15873
b3 PR15873
rc ???
LocalAuthenticationEmbeddedUI b1 mandel
- - b1 mande
rc ???
MailKit - - - b1 nothing
b2 nothing
rc ???
MapKit b1 PR15562
b2 PR15562
b5 PR15562
b1 PR15562
b2 PR15562
b5 PR15562
b1 PR15562
b2 PR15562
b1 PR15562
b2 PR15562
b5 PR15562
rc ???
Matter b5 nothing
b5 nothing
b5 nothing
-
MediaPlayer b1 PR15654
b5 PR15654
b1 PR15654
b5 PR15654
b1 PR15654
b5 PR15654
b1 PR15654
b5 PR15654
rc ???
MessageUI b1 PR15652
b2 PR15652
- - -
Metal b1 ???
b2 ???
b3 ???
b4 ???
b5 ???
b1 ???
b2 ???
b3 ???
b4 ???
b5 ???
- b1 ???
b2 ???
b3 ???
b4 ???
b5 ???
rc ???
MetalFX b1 ???
b2 ???
b4 ???
b5 ???
- - b1 ???
b2 ???
b4 ???
b5 ???
rc ???
MetalKit b1 ???
b1 ???
- b1 ???
rc ???
MetalPerformanceShadersGraph b1 ???
b4 ???
b5 ???
b1 ???
b4 ???
b5 ???
- b1 ???
b4 ???
b5 ???
rc ???
MetricKit b1 PR15629
b3 PR15629
b1 PR15629
b3 PR15629
- b1 PR15629
b3 PR15629
rc ???
ModelIO b1 PR15715
b1 PR15715
- b1 PR15715
rc ???
MPSCore b4 ???
b4 ???
- b4 ???
rc ???
NaturalLanguage b2 PR15718
b2 PR15718
b2 PR15718
b2 PR15718
rc ???
NearbyInteraction b1 PR15840
- b1 PR15840
b1 PR15840
rc ???
Network b1 PR15841
b3 PR15841
b1 PR15841
b3 PR15841
b1 PR15841
b3 PR15841
b1 PR15841
b2 PR15841
b3 PR15841
rc ???
NetworkExtension b1 PR15847
- b1 PR15847
b1 PR15847
rc ???
PassKit b1 PR15613
b2 PR15613
b3 PR15613
b4 PR15613
- b1 PR15613
b2 PR15613
b3 PR15613
b4 PR15613
b1 PR15613
b2 PR15613
b3 PR15613
b4 PR15613
b5 PR15613
rc ???
PDFKit b1 PR15628
b2 PR15628
b4 PR15628
- - b1 PR15628
b2 PR15628
b5 PR15628
rc ???
PencilKit b5 PR15702
- - b5 PR15702
rc ???
PHASE b1 PR15638
b1 PR15638
- b1 PR15638
rc ???
Photos b1 PR15608
b3 PR15608
b4 PR15608
b1 PR15608
b3 PR15608
b4 PR15608
- b1 PR15608
b3 PR15608
b4 PR15608
rc ???
PhotosUI b1 PR15608
b1 PR15608
b1 PR15608
b1 PR15608
rc ???
PrintCore - - - b1 mandel
rc ???
PushKit b1 PR15637
- b1 PR15637
b1 PR15637
rc ???
PushToTalk b1 PR15645
b2 PR15645
b4 PR15645
- b1 PR15645
b2 PR15645
b5 nothing
b1 PR15645
b2 PR15645
rc ???
QuartzCore b1 ???
b1 ???
- b1 ???
rc ???
QuickLook b1 nothing
- - -
QuickLookUI - - - b1 nothing
rc ???
ReplayKit b1 nothing
b1 nothing
- b1 nothing
rc ???
RoomPlan b1 nothing
- - -
SafariServices b1 PR15635
- - -
SafetyKit rc issoto
- - -
SceneKit b1 nothing
b2 nothing
b1 nothing
b2 nothing
b1 nothing
b2 nothing
b1 nothing
b2 nothing
rc ???
ScreenCaptureKit - - - b1 PR15647
b2 PR15647
rc ???
Security b1 nothing
b2 nothing
b1 nothing
b2 nothing
b1 nothing
b2 nothing
b1 nothing
b2 nothing
b3 nothing
b4 nothing
rc ???
SharedWithYou b1 PR15819
b2 PR15819
b3 PR15819
b4 PR15819
b5 PR15819
b1 PR15819
b2 PR15819
b3 PR15819
b4 PR15819
b5 PR15819
- b1 PR15819
b2 PR15819
b3 PR15819
b4 PR15819
b5 PR15819
rc ???
SharedWithYouCore b1 PR15634
b2 PR15634
b4 PR15634
b5 nothing
b1 PR15634
b2 PR15634
b4 PR15634
b5 nothing
- b1 PR15634
b2 PR15634
b4 PR15634
b5 nothing
rc ???
ShazamKit b1 PR15539
b2 PR15539
b1 PR15539
b2 PR15539
b1 PR15539
b2 PR15539
b1 PR15539
b2 PR15539
rc ???
Speech b1 PR15627
b2 PR15627
- - b1 PR15627
b2 PR15627
rc ???
SpeechSynthesis - - - b1 PR15627
rc ???
SpriteKit b1 PR15626
b1 PR15626
b1 PR15626
b1 PR15626
rc ???
StoreKit b1 PR15609
b1 PR15609
b1 PR15609
b1 PR15609
rc ???
SystemConfiguration b1 nothing
b1 nothing
- b1 nothing
rc ???
ThreadNetwork b1 PR15555
- - -
TVServices - b2 PR15553
- -
UIKit b1 PR15694
b2 PR15694
b3 PR15694
b4 PR15694
b5 PR15694
b1 PR15694
b2 PR15694
b3 PR15694
b4 PR15694
b5 PR15694
b1 PR15694
b2 PR15694
b3 PR15694
b4 PR15694
b5 PR15694
-
UniformTypeIdentifiers b1 PR15550
b1 PR15550
b1 PR15550
b1 PR15550
rc ???
UserNotifications b1 PR15544
b2 PR15544
b3 PR15544
b1 PR15544
b2 PR15544
b3 PR15544
b1 PR15544
b2 PR15544
b3 PR15544
b1 PR15544
b2 PR15544
b3 PR15544
rc ???
VideoSubscriberAccount b1 PR15541
b5 PR15699
b1 PR15541
b5 PR15699
- b1 PR15541
b5 PR15699
rc ???
VideoToolbox b1 PR15845
b2 PR15845
b3 PR15845
b1 PR15845
b2 PR15845
b3 PR15845
- b1 PR15845
b2 PR15845
b3 PR15845
rc ???
vImage b1 nothing
b1 nothing
b1 nothing
b1 nothing
rc ???
Vision b1 PR15538
b1 PR15538
b2 PR15538
- b1 PR15538
rc ???
VisionKit b1 nothing
- - b1 nothing
rc ???
WatchKit - - b1 PR15535
b2 PR15535
rc ???
-
WebKit b1 PR15525
b2 PR15525
b3 PR15525
b5 PR15700
- - b1 PR15525
b3 PR15525
b5 PR15700
rc ???
WidgetKit - - b1 nothing
-

❓ HOWTO

  • When picking a framework: add your name to the API diff itself, below the framework name. E.g: ## Sebastien.
  • When you create a PR for a given framework, please add the PR URL instead of your name. E.g: https://github.com/link/to/PR.
  • Finally run make to regenerate the table, git add xcode11/ and git commit (substitute xcode11 with the current binding season).

⚠️ Warnings

  • Please never remove content, except for noise, from the diffs files (needed by reviewers).
  • Never update the Bindings-Status.md file directly, always update the diffs files and do make.
  • A PR URL in the bindings file shows the work done/being-done and not what the current packages ship.

ℹ️ Legend

  • *nothing* **means there is no new bindings in the frameworks in strikeout (e.g. noise in the headers).
  • The bindings are not complete for frameworks in bold.
  • Bindings are done (does not mean tested or final) for frameworks without text decorations.
Clone this wiki locally